Zauba

JHS%20SVENDGAARD%20MECHANICAL%20AND%20WAREHOUSE%20PRIVATE%20LIMITEDCIN: U29199DL2007PTC159125
new.inc
JHS SVENDGAARD MECHANICAL AND WAREHOUSE PRIVATE LIMITED | Zauba